Author: Rick Good

Rick Good spent ten years in the newspaper business, including with The News & Observer (Raleigh, NC) and The Greenville News (Greenville, SC). He co-wrote, with Melinda Coleman, Rutledge to Riley: Governors of South Carolina, 1776–Present (Published by The Greenville News), and is the author of Mind Games Trivia #1 (Amazon). He has recently spent 15 years creating original trivia content through Sounds Good Mobile Entertainment and continues that with his new company, SGME Software. He edits The Smart Reader's money, real estate, and business coverage.
